  • Big Ten football to resume weekend of Oct. 24 (President Praised)

    09/16/2020 6:32:51 PM PDT · by God luvs America · 48 replies
    ESPN ^ | 9/16/2020 | Adam Rittenberg & Heather Dinich
    The Big Ten will kick off its football season the weekend of Oct. 24 after the league's presidents and chancellors unanimously voted to resume competition, citing daily testing capabilities and a stronger confidence in the latest medical information, the conference announced Wednesday morning. Each team will attempt to play eight games in eight weeks, leaving no wiggle room during the coronavirus pandemic before the Big Ten championship game on Dec. 19. That date will also feature an extra cross-division game for each school, with seeded teams in each division squaring off. The Big Ten would complete its season before the...

  • Fed holds rates steady near zero and indicates it will stay there for years

    09/16/2020 6:12:00 PM PDT · by Moonman62 · 20 replies
    CNBC ^ | 09/16/20 | Jeff Cox
    The Federal Reserve kept its pledge to keep interest rates anchored near zero and promised to keep rates there until inflation rises consistently. As the central bank concluded its two-day policy meeting Wednesday, it said short-term rates would remain targeted at 0%-0.25%. Officials also changed their economic forecasts to reflect a smaller decline in GDP and a lower unemployment rate in 2020. Projections from individual members also indicated that rates could stay anchored near zero through 2023. All but four members indicated they see zero rates through then. This was the first time the committee forecast its outlook for 2023....

  • Astronomy Picture of the Day - Gravel Ejected from Asteroid Bennu

    09/16/2020 5:54:43 PM PDT · by MtnClimber · 15 replies
    APOD.NASA.gov ^ | 16 Sep, 2020 | Image Credit: NASA's GSFC, U. Arizona, OSIRIS-REx Lockheed Martin
    Explanation: Why does asteroid Bennu eject gravel into space? No one is sure. The discovery, occurring during several episodes by NASA's visiting OSIRIS-REx spacecraft, was unexpected. Leading ejection hypotheses include impacts by Sun-orbiting meteoroids, sudden thermal fractures of internal structures, and the sudden release of a water vapor jet. The featured two-image composite shows an ejection event that occurred in early 2019, with sun-reflecting ejecta seen on the right. Data and simulations show that large gravel typically falls right back to the rotating 500-meter asteroid, while smaller rocks skip around the surface, and the smallest rocks completely escape the low...
